The St Vincent de Paul Society provides exciting career opportunities for people who have the desire to apply their professional skills in a job that gives back to the community.
We are a predominantly volunteer-run organisation, and employees undertake a cross-section of administrative, coordinator and management roles.
We pride ourselves on employing talented and enthusiastic individuals who want to make a difference in our community, and we are committed to creating a workforce that is as diverse as our society. As an Equal Opportunity Employer, we encourage applications from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people, and people of all abilities, cultures, orientations and backgrounds.
